Health officials report 3 deaths, 408 fresh cases of dengue inflection overnight

BSS
Published On: 07 Aug 2025, 18:27

DHAKA, Aug 07, 2025 (BSS) - Health officials today said they recorded 408 fresh cases of dengue onslaughts killing at least three persons in the past 24 hours with most patients reporting in health facilities in southwestern Barishal region.

"During the period, (of the 408) 73 patients were hospitalized in Barishal division" which appeared to have been the worst victim of the mosquito carried diseases, a Directorate General of Health Services (DGHS) statement said.

It said among the rests, 58 were hospitalized in Chattogram division, 59 in Dhaka division excluding the capital, 57 in Dhaka South City Corporation (DSCC) and 37 in Dhaka North City Corporation (DNCC) areas, 25 in Mymensingh division, 52 in Rajshahi division, seven in Rangpur division and three in Sylhet division.

Since the start of the dengue onslaughts Bangladesh this year witnessed so far 95 deaths while the disease inflicted 23,220.

The dengue last year claimed 575 lives and inflicted 1,01,214 people in the country.
